Biography

Maurice Desaymonet was capped 28 times with the French national team between 1948 and 1950. He won Olympic silver in 1948, an European Championships silver in 1949, and was sixth at the 1950 World Championships. At the club level, Desaymonet played his entire career with Championnet Sports, winning the French title with them in 1945. By profession Desaymonet was a bank clerk.
